Catherine B. Laneve, formerly of Newell, twin sister of Elizabeth A. Laneve, who preceded her in death, passed away at the Orchards of East Liverpool on Sunday, May 11, 2025.
Catherine was 74 years old, and she was born in East Liverpool on October 8,1950. She was the daughter of the late Anthony F. and Nancy Musuraca Laneve.
Survivors include her sisters, Eleanor (Alfred) Ames of Luray, Virginia, and Nancy (Steve) Barlow of East Liverpool, her brothers, Carmen Laneve of East Liverpool, and Anthony (Tony) Laneve of Newell,
her nephews and niece, Mark (Katarina) Barlow, Joe (Allison) Laneve, and Emily (Matt)Onufrak, and great-nieces and nephews, Iliana Barlow, Luke, Jacob and Christopher Onufrak, Leo and Christine Jayne Laneve.
Catherine retired from the Hancock County Sheltered Workshop and at one time had a paper route in Wellsburg. She had also been very active in Special Olympics and was a member of the Sacred Heart Catholic Church.
Father Bill Matheny will preside for the Catholic Funeral Liturgy at the Sacred Heart Church on Tuesday May 13, at 10:00 am. Sacred Heart Parishioners will recite the Rosary at 9:30 am, prior to Mass. Interment will follow at
Shadow Lawn Memorial Gardens in Newell.
